About this course
The specialization "Leading Technical Organizations" is intended for post-graduate students seeking to develop advanced leadership skills for technical environments. Through three courses, you will explore key leadership theories, inclusive leadership practices, strategic planning, change management, and coalition building. Foundations of Leadership examines critical thinking, behavioral approaches, and ethical leadership, laying the foundation for effective leadership. Strategic and Inclusive Leadership emphasizes inclusive leadership strategies, personal development, and crisis management. Leadership in Action and Planning provides hands-on experience in strategic planning, managing change, and building coalitions. By the end of the specialization, you will develop a comprehensive 10-year personal and professional strategic plan to lead effectively in technical settings. This specialization equips you with the tools to excel in leadership roles, enabling you to drive organizational success and growth through strategic vision, adaptability, and inclusivity.
